1. What Are Toyota Genuine Spark Plugs SK16HR11?
The SK16HR11 is a factory-original spark plug supplied by Toyota and manufactured by trusted OEM suppliers, such as Denso, known for producing high-performance ignition components. This specific spark plug uses iridium-tipped technology, making it ideal for long service intervals, enhanced combustion, and smoother engine operation.
It is used in a wide range of Toyota and Lexus models and is designed to meet Toyota’s stringent engine performance and emissions standards.
2. Key Specifications and Construction
-
Part Number: SK16HR11
-
Type: Iridium spark plug
-
Electrode Gap: 1.1 mm (factory pre-set)
-
Thread Size: M12 x 1.25
-
Hex Size: 14 mm
-
Heat Range: 16
-
Terminal Type: Solid type
-
Seat Type: Flat
Material and Design Highlights:
-
Iridium-Tipped Center Electrode: Provides a fine-tipped electrode with high melting point and durability.
-
Platinum Ground Electrode Pad: Adds wear resistance for consistent performance over time.
-
U-Groove Design: Enhances flame propagation and combustion efficiency.
-
Anti-Seize Nickel Plating: Prevents thread galling and corrosion.
-
Multi-Rib Insulator: Prevents flashover and ensures strong electrical insulation.
3. Functions of Spark Plugs in an Engine
The SK16HR11, like any spark plug, performs three essential roles in internal combustion engines:
a) Ignition of Air-Fuel Mixture
It delivers high-voltage electric sparks across the electrode gap, igniting the air-fuel mixture in the combustion chamber.
b) Heat Dissipation
Transfers heat from the combustion chamber to the cylinder head, helping regulate engine temperature and prevent pre-ignition or knocking.
c) Sealing the Combustion Chamber
Maintains compression within the cylinder by sealing off the combustion chamber through its threaded body and insulator design.

5. Signs of Worn or Failing Spark Plugs
Even durable spark plugs like the SK16HR11 degrade over time. Recognizing signs of wear helps prevent bigger engine issues:
-
Difficulty Starting the Engine – Spark plugs that fail to ignite the fuel-air mixture can cause hard starting.
-
Poor Acceleration – Weak sparks lead to incomplete combustion and sluggish performance.
-
Increased Fuel Consumption – Worn plugs may require more fuel to generate sufficient power.
-
Rough Idling – A misfiring plug can cause the engine to shake or run unevenly at idle.
-
Check Engine Light – Modern ECUs detect misfires or poor ignition timing caused by bad plugs.
-
Engine Misfires – Audible sputtering, hesitation, or jerking under load can point to plug issues.
6. Installation Guidelines
To ensure the longevity and performance of the SK16HR11, proper installation is essential:
Tools Needed:
-
Torque wrench
-
Spark plug socket (14 mm)
-
Ratchet and extension
-
Anti-seize compound (if not pre-coated)
-
Dielectric grease (optional, for coil boots)
Installation Steps:
-
Allow the engine to cool completely before starting.
-
Remove ignition coils or plug wires as required to access the plugs.
-
Clean the plug area to avoid debris falling into the cylinder.
-
Use a spark plug socket to remove the old plug gently.
-
Inspect new plug for damage; check gap (though factory pre-gapped).
-
Apply anti-seize to threads (only if not pre-coated) and dielectric grease to boot if desired.
-
Install the new plug and hand-tighten.
-
Torque to specifications (typically 18–21 Nm for M12 plugs; refer to manufacturer guide).
-
Reinstall coils or plug wires and secure connections.
7. Maintenance and Replacement Interval
Toyota typically recommends replacing iridium spark plugs every 96,000 to 160,000 km (60,000 to 100,000 miles), depending on vehicle model and engine type. For peak performance:
-
Check spark plugs every 40,000–50,000 km
-
Inspect ignition coils when replacing plugs
-
Monitor engine performance and fuel consumption to detect early signs of spark degradation
8. Applications and Compatibility
The SK16HR11 spark plug is compatible with a variety of Toyota and Lexus models equipped with inline-4 and V6 engines. Common applications include:
-
Toyota Corolla
-
Toyota RAV4
-
Toyota Camry
-
Toyota Prius
-
Toyota Hilux
-
Toyota Harrier
-
Lexus RX and ES series (varies by engine code)
Always confirm compatibility using the vehicle’s VIN or checking the owner’s manual.
